    Equipment for the conveying and recovery of hydrocarbons from an underwater well for the extraction of hydrocarbons, under uncontrolled release conditions

    No full text
    The present invention relates to equipment for the conveying and recovery of hydrocarbons from an underwater well for the extraction of hydrocarbons under uncontrolled release conditions, comprising a chamber (23) for the separation of the hydrocarbon stream leaving the well, into a heavy phase (23 a) and a light phase (23 b), means (15,16,17,24,25,26) being envisaged, in connection with the separation chamber (23), for conveying the heavy phase (23 a) and light phase (23 b) towards the surface, characterized in that it comprises a directioning body (18) of the hydrocarbon stream, having a substantially cylindrical shape, or as a truncated paraboloid with both ends open, wherein a first end is an inlet of the hydrocarbon stream leaving the well, and a second end, distal with respect to the inlet of the hydrocarbon stream (20), is in fluid connection with the separation chamber (23) with the interpositioning of a perforated spherical cap (22)

    Hersh SMOLAR, Le ghetto de Minsk

    No full text
    Le dernier ghetto d’Europe : voici comment le vaste camp de concentration urbain de Minsk pourrait être qualifié. Définitivement anéanti en octobre 1943, il avait « abrité » plus de 100 000 Juifs, principalement soviétiques, mais aussi polonais ou encore allemands. Son histoire, en France, est peu connue, car restée à l’ombre d’événements majeurs, comme l’insurrection du ghetto de Varsovie, la révolte de Sobibor ou le combat pour la survie de la communauté de partisans juifs des frères Bel´s..

    Geographies: Writing the Shtetl into the Ghetto

    No full text
    I am interested, first of all, in the logic of the transition from “tenement” to “ghetto” in the work of the sociologists from the Chicago School, arguably the earliest theorists of the city in the U.S., and, secondly, in how and why the Jewish ghetto became the archetypal ghetto in their work. In the sociological imagination, Jewish immigrants were seen as a group that wanted to Americanize but that also wished to remain apart; the ghetto emblematized, as it gave spatial expression to, that position and thereby exemplified Americanization as the sociologists defined and facilitated it. This essay explores both how the Jewish ghetto evolved as the expression of the sociologists’ understanding of Americanization and how the metaphor of contagion became central to that process. It is part of a larger project on contagion and Americanism in the twentieth century

    Henekh, un enfant juif échappé du ghetto, de Yankev Pat

    No full text
    Dans son ouvrage Henekh : a yidish kind vos iz aroys fun geto, publié dans la collection « Dos poylishe yidntum » en 1948, Yankev Pat reprend le témoignage écrit d'un jeune garçon juif polonais, Henekh, échappé à plusieurs reprises du ghetto de Varsovie1. Henekh, âgé de 10 ans en 1940, vit dans le ghetto de Varsovie avec son grand frère Borukh, sa petite sœur Gitele et ses parents.
